The Dell PowerEdge XE9680 is a 6U rack server designed for high-performance AI and machine learning workloads. It features 8 NVIDIA HGX H100 80GB 700W SXM5 GPUs, interconnected with NVIDIA NVLink technology. The server also includes two 5th or 4th generation Intel Xeon Scalable processors, up to 4TB of DDR5 memory, and various storage options.
Here’s a more detailed breakdown:
Key Features:
Accelerators: 8x NVIDIA HGX H100 80GB 700W SXM5 GPUs.
Processors: Two 5th or 4th Generation Intel Xeon Scalable processors.
Memory: 32 DDR5 DIMM slots, supporting up to 4TB of RAM.
Storage: Up to 8 x 2.5-inch NVMe/SAS/SATA SSD drives (122.88 TB max).
Form Factor: 6U rack server.
Networking: 2x 1 GbE LOM and options for OCP NIC 3.0 (25GbE or 10GbE).
Power: Redundant 2800W Titanium power supplies.
Additional Information:
The XE9680 is Dell’s first 8-GPU platform, optimized for AI, machine learning, and high-performance computing.
It supports various operating systems, including Canonical Ubuntu Server LTS, Red Hat Enterprise Linux, SUSE Linux Enterprise Server, and VMware ESXi.
The server features advanced security measures like cryptographically signed firmware, data at rest encryption, and secure boot.
It is designed for demanding workloads like generative AI training, model customization, and large-scale AI inferencing.
